What is the Difference Between Longitudinal and Transverse Dual-Clutch Transmissions?

The differences between longitudinal and transverse dual-clutch transmissions: 1. Different placement directions of the dual-clutch transmission: The transverse dual-clutch is placed horizontally, requiring the transmission to be placed side by side in a horizontal arrangement. The longitudinal dual-clutch is placed vertically, with the transmission positioned behind the engine. 2. Different power output directions: The power transmission direction of the transverse dual-clutch is typically perpendicular to the car's forward direction, and after entering the transmission, the power is usually transmitted horizontally, directly into the half-shaft. The power transmission direction of the longitudinal dual-clutch is parallel to the car's movement direction, transmitting backward, and after entering the transmission, it continues to transmit longitudinally backward, usually connecting to the central drive shaft for direct rearward transmission. 3. Different car drivetrain configurations: Transverse dual-clutch transmissions are typically used in front-engine, front-wheel-drive setups, while longitudinal dual-clutch transmissions are usually found in front-engine, rear-wheel-drive configurations. 4. Different suspension systems: Generally, vehicles with a longitudinal dual-clutch layout, due to smaller lateral space requirements, can often save significant space, allowing for the installation of more advanced multi-link or double-wishbone suspension systems. For transverse dual-clutch layouts, since the dual-clutch is longer and the transmission must be placed side by side, higher demands are placed on lateral space usage. 5. Different space occupancies: Also due to the size of the dual-clutch, the longitudinal dual-clutch engine occupies significantly more space in the cabin.

I've been in the auto repair business for over twenty years and have seen all kinds of dual-clutch transmissions with significant layout differences. Longitudinal dual-clutch setups are typically used in vehicles with longitudinally mounted engines, such as rear-wheel or all-wheel-drive performance models. The design follows the engine's long axis direction to balance weight distribution and enhance high-speed stability, but they have more components, complex structures, and can be labor-intensive and costly to repair. Transverse dual-clutch transmissions are common in most front-wheel-drive family cars, where the engine is mounted sideways, and the transmission is also arranged horizontally to save engine bay space, making the cabin roomier. They feel nimble to drive with quick shifts but may have some jerkiness or noise. My advice when choosing a car: longitudinal setups suit those pursuing driving pleasure, while transverse ones are fuel-efficient and hassle-free, but both require regular maintenance to avoid overheating issues. Routine maintenance should include checking fluids and sensors to extend their lifespan.

Are Night Vision Glasses Useful for Driving?

Night vision glasses are useful when driving at night. Below are the functions and classifications of night vision glasses: Functions of night vision glasses: They can effectively prevent headlight glare, enhance color saturation, and make the field of vision brighter and clearer. Generally, car night vision glasses appear golden yellow with a metallic-like coating on the surface. Classifications of night vision glasses: Infrared night vision glasses are further divided into two types: active and passive. Active night vision glasses emit a beam of infrared light that reflects off objects and returns, similar to a flashlight. Passive night vision glasses amplify the infrared light emitted by objects themselves and convert it into visible light. Low-light night vision glasses amplify faint light to present a clear image in the field of vision.

What type of gasoline should be used for the XT5?

The fuel tank capacity of the Cadillac XT5 varies between 73 liters and 82 liters depending on the model version, and the manufacturer recommends using 95-octane gasoline. After the vehicle is parked and turned off, press the side of the fuel tank cover to open it. Below is an introduction to the Cadillac XT5: 1. Exterior: The Cadillac XT5 is a four-door, five-seat SUV with body dimensions of 4812mm in length, 1903mm in width, and 1680mm in height, and a wheelbase of 2857mm. The trunk capacity is 584 liters, and the second-row seats support a one-touch folding function, expanding the trunk space to a maximum of 1634 liters. 2. Powertrain: The Cadillac XT5 offers two differently tuned 2.0T turbocharged direct-injection engines, with maximum power outputs of 184kW and 198kW respectively, both delivering a peak torque of 400Nm. The engines are paired with an 8-speed automatic transmission featuring Start/Stop energy-saving technology.

What procedures are required for vehicle modification?

Vehicle modification requires the following procedures: 1. Legal requirements: According to Article 11 of the "Motor Vehicle Registration Regulations," when applying for modification registration, the motor vehicle owner shall fill out an application form, present the motor vehicle for inspection, and submit the following documents and certificates: the identity proof of the motor vehicle owner; the motor vehicle registration certificate; the motor vehicle license; if the engine, body, or frame is replaced, a motor vehicle safety technical inspection certificate shall also be submitted; if the entire vehicle is replaced due to quality issues, a motor vehicle safety technical inspection certificate shall also be submitted, except for motor vehicles imported through customs and those exempted from safety technical inspection as recognized by the competent motor vehicle product department of the State Council. 2. Notes: The vehicle management office shall, within one day from the date of acceptance, confirm the motor vehicle, review the submitted documents and certificates, note the modification items on the motor vehicle registration certificate, retrieve the license, and reissue a new license. When handling the modification registration items specified in items (3), (4), and (6) of the first paragraph of Article 10 of these regulations, the vehicle management office shall verify the vehicle identification number imprint.

What Should Drivers Pay Attention to When Overtaking?

Drivers should pay attention to safety confirmation, speed, and distance when overtaking. The specific considerations for drivers when overtaking are as follows: Safety First: Before overtaking, the driver should fully understand the acceleration performance of their vehicle. Ensure that components such as the horn, turn signals, and headlights are functioning properly. Choose a straight, wide road with good visibility, no obstacles on either side, and no oncoming vehicles within 150 meters ahead. Only proceed with overtaking when safety is guaranteed. Avoid blindly overtaking without considering subjective and objective conditions. Speed Consideration: When overtaking, try to increase the speed difference between the two vehicles as much as possible to reduce the overtaking distance and time, ensuring a quick completion of the maneuver. Distance Awareness: When overtaking a parked vehicle, lift the accelerator pedal to use the engine's drag resistance to decelerate, honk the horn more frequently, stay alert, increase the lateral distance from the parked vehicle, and be prepared to stop in case of emergencies.

Do Manual Transmission Cars Have Paddle Shifters?

Manual transmission cars do not have paddle shifters. Here is the relevant information: 1. Function of Paddle Shifters: Paddle shifters are gear-shifting devices installed for cars with semi-automatic clutches, allowing gear changes without pressing the clutch pedal by simply pulling the paddle shifter. Since paddle shifters are located behind the steering wheel, shifting gears is very convenient and efficient. This device is widely used in rally racing, circuit racing, and even F1 events. As a quick-shifting device, paddle shifters significantly enhance driving operability. They are typically positioned behind the steering wheel. When using paddle shifters, drivers usually only need to shift the gear into D, S, or manual mode. With paddle shifters, drivers can perform upshifts and downshifts without taking their hands off the steering wheel. 2. Introduction to Manual Transmission: Manual transmission cars use a manual gear-shifting mechanical transmission (also known as manual gearbox, MT) to adjust vehicle speed. This means the driver must manually move the gear lever to change the gear engagement positions inside the transmission, altering the gear ratio to achieve speed changes. The gear lever can only be moved when the clutch pedal is depressed.
